Lovely host but a very uncomfortable bed

6.0

The host was lovely. Very welcoming. The accommodation is cosy with great little touches. It has a small cooking unit and fridge. There was free WIFI. Very quite location.

I was very, very lucky and got a parking space close to the house BUT in the evening I think this would be very difficult and you could end up streets away. The main thing for me was that the bed was so uncomfortable. It has a very thin mattress and you can feel the hard bars under it running across the bed. I did not sleep well and woke up with my back and hips aching. It just needs a decent topper and it would be ok. I don't think I would want to share it with someone - it is really not that big. The bathroom is ok - but tiny. You have to pull in your legs and hold the the door shut when sitting on the toilet (ok if it's just one person). Also I had to kneel on the toilet seat to reach the sink to clean my teeth! I wouldn't stay again mainly because of the bed and the parking but apart from that I felt it was expensive for what it was. Maybe it's a premium because of being close to Harry Potter world but that wasn't of interest to me. I think Watford is expensive but if I went there again I would pay more to have a comfy bed.
